Filing 77 ORDER GRANTING Plf's 76 Motion for Court to find that Service has been made on Defendant UnitedHealthcare Plan of the Valley, Inc. Signed by Judge Callie V. S. Granade on 8/30/10. (tot) |
Filing 45 ORDER re: 37 motion to amend order of District Judge adopting Report and Recommendation and 39 motion to disburse interpleaded proceeds. Plaintiff's 37 Motion to Amend is GRANTED to the extent that the plaintiff will be allowed to amend t he complaint to add all known lienholders as additional defendants in this case. The court will refrain from distributing any funds to any defendants until the lienholders have had a chance to answer the complaint and assert their claims, if any, to the interpled funds. Plaintiff is hereby ORDERED to file an amended complaint on or before January 8, 2010. Signed by Chief Judge Callie V. S. Granade on 12/23/2009. (mab) |
Filing 36 JUDGMENT that the Motion for Default Judgment against Dft Jonathan Brian Childers is GRANTED, & Plf American National General Ins. Co. is discharged from further liability under the subject insurance policy by reason of the automobile accident as set out. Signed by Chief Judge Callie V. S. Granade on 10/2/09. (copy mailed to Dft Childers on 10/2/09) (tot) |
Filing 31 REPORT AND RECOMMENDATION recommending that Plf's 24 MOTION for Default Judgment against Dft Jonathan Brian Childers be GRANTED & that Plf be discharged from further liability under the subject policy as set out. Objections to R&R due by 9/17/2009. Signed by Magistrate Judge William E. Cassady on 9/2/09. (tot) |
